It is important to acknowledge that the Camera Raw download for CS6 has a ceiling. Adobe stopped updating the plugin for CS6 at version 8.4. Consequently, if a photographer purchases a camera released after mid-2014, CS6 will not be able to open those raw files natively. This limitation forces users to make a choice: upgrade to the Creative Cloud subscription, use the free Adobe DNG Converter to translate files into a readable format, or stick with older camera hardware.
